-- ブルームバーグ通信は火曜日、ポルトガルの財務大臣の発言を引用し、イラン内戦勃発後の消費者と企業へのコスト高騰の影響を緩和するため、ポルトガルがエネルギー企業への超過利益税導入案を進める方針だと報じた。 ジョアキン・ミランダ・サルメント財務大臣は、エネルギー企業の利益に対するこの課税案は、2022年のエネルギー危機時に実施された措置をモデルにするものだと述べた。 「2022年に採択された措置を微調整・改善し、近いうちに議会に提案を提出する」とサルメント大臣は述べたと伝えられている。 ポルトガル財務省は、MTニュースワイヤーズのコメント要請にすぐには応じなかった。 ポルトガルは、ドイツやスペインを含むEU加盟国グループの一員として、先月欧州委員会に宛てた書簡で、エネルギー企業の利益に対する超過利益税の導入を求めた。 サルメント氏は、署名国は政策対応を調整し、他の加盟国にもこのイニシアチブへの参加を呼びかける意向だと述べた。 「2022年に採択された措置を微調整・改善し、近い将来、欧州議会に提案を提出する予定だ」と同氏は語った。 欧州委員会はこうした措置に関する最終決定を各加盟国に委ねる意向を示しているものの、ポルトガルとその同盟国は、EU全体で各国の戦略を整合させる枠組みを求めている。 中東危機が続く中、ホルムズ海峡を経由する船舶の航行がほぼ停止し、石油と液化天然ガスの重要な供給ルートが寸断されたため、世界のエネルギー価格は過去最高値にまで高騰している。 (マーケットチャッターのニュースは、世界中の市場専門家との会話に基づいています。この情報は信頼できる情報源に基づいていると考えられますが、噂や憶測が含まれている可能性があります。正確性は保証されません。)

Trump Calls Oil Price Surge 'Very Small Price to Pay,' Says Iran Wants to Secure Deal
US President Donald Trump said rising oil prices were a "very small price to pay" in the near term amid the ongoing Middle East conflict.Trump made the remarks while responding to reporters during a signing of a proclamation on the National Physical Fitness and Sports Month held at the White House."I thought oil would go to $200, $250, maybe $300, and I know it will be short-term... I look today, it's like at $102," Trump said, adding that's "a very small price to pay" for getting rid of an Iranian nuclear weapon.On shipping congestion in the Strait of Hormuz, Trump said Tuesday that about 400 ships are stranded there amid the ongoing Middle East conflict, adding, "...some of these tankers hold 2 million barrels..."Trump said Iran is seeking negotiations, signaling renewed pressure to secure a deal. "Iran wants to make a deal... they'll talk to me with such great respect, and then they'll go on television, they'll say, we did not speak to the President."He added that Iran should do make the right move to avoid military escalations. "They should do the smart thing... because we don't want to go in and kill people," Trump said, stressing preference for a negotiated outcome.Trump said Iran faces economic collapse with inflation near 150% as sanctions intensify."Their currency is worthless. Their inflation is probably 150%... they aren't paying their soldiers," Trump said, highlighting severe economic deterioration.He described US enforcement measures, saying the blockade is "It's like a piece of steel. Nobody is going to challenge the blockade," underscoring strict control over maritime routes.On the South Korean vessel hit by Iran on Monday in the Strait of Hormuz, Trump said, "They decided to go it alone, and their ship got the hell knocked out of it yesterday. But they didn't shoot the ships that were guarded by us."On China, Trump said he maintains a strong relationship with President Xi and plans to discuss Iran as part of broader geopolitical and energy considerations."... he gets like 60% of his oil from Hormuz," Trump said, underscoring China's exposure to the region's energy flows.He said the US has encouraged China to diversify supply routes, adding, "... send your ships to Texas... send your ships to Louisiana... Send your ships to Alaska," pointing to alternative energy sourcing options.Japan gets 90% of its oil, and South Korea 43%, from the Middle East, Trump said, highlighting the vulnerability to supply disruptions.Countries are "learning" to buy oil from the United States... they're changing their habits," Trump said, pointing to shifting global trade patterns.
